What is a Dimmer Switch?

A dimmer switch is a device that helps to vary the intensity of an electric light. It is installed in place of a regular switch and usually includes a rotary or sliding knob that allows users to adjust the light’s brightness. Dimmer switches are typically used with LED and incandescent lights, and they help to reduce energy consumption and extend the lifespan of the bulbs.

Moreover, dimmer switches help to create ambiance and mood lighting options in your living space, making them a must-have in every home. However, before you install a dimmer switch, you must understand its wiring diagram to avoid any electrical hazards or malfunctions.

Installation Process

Now that you understand the wiring diagram let’s discuss the installation process:

Step 1: Turn off the power supply at the circuit breaker. This is crucial to avoid electrocution.

Step 2: Remove the existing light switch cover and switch.

Step 3: Connect the wires from the switch to the dimmer switch according to the wiring diagram. Use wire connectors to secure each wire connection.

Step 4: Mount the dimmer switch into the electrical box and attach it to the wall-plate using the screws provided.

Step 5: Turn on the power supply and test the dimmer switch to ensure it’s functioning correctly.

4. What’s the difference between a single-pole and a three-way dimmer switch?

A single-pole dimmer switch is used to control a single light fixture from one location, while a three-way dimmer switch can control the same light fixture from two or more locations. A three-way dimmer switch requires a special wiring diagram to ensure proper installation.
